<b>Based on Jack Kerouac's real-life love affair in Mexico City this novel follows a man's doomed relationship with a woman as her life spirals out of control.</b><br><b> </b><br><b>[Kerouac] loves language and he obviously has a profound feeling for the human race. . . . In the end he is more truthful entertaining and honest than most writers on the American scene.--<i>The New York Times Book Review</i></b> <p/>This short novel which Jack Kerouac wrote in the mid-1950s tells of an American man's ill-fated romance with an exotic happy-go-lucky Mexican prostitute and morphine addict. Tristessa who is Indian and a deeply religious Catholic lives in a room in a Mexico City slum with another addict and a menagerie of pets. After meeting her the narrator leaves town for a year to travel in America and upon his return he finds Tristessa beginning to fall apart at the seams. <p/>This elegiac novel is both a haunting evocation of a spectral Mexico City and a moving meditation on a young woman's pain and suffering.
